首页 >> 速报 > 经验问答 >

数据库设计的基本步骤

2025-09-24 00:09:44

问题描述:

数据库设计的基本步骤,在线等,很急,求回复!

最佳答案

推荐答案

2025-09-24 00:09:44

数据库设计的基本步骤】数据库设计是构建信息系统的重要环节,良好的数据库设计能够提高系统的性能、可维护性和数据的一致性。数据库设计过程通常包括多个阶段,每个阶段都有其特定的目标和任务。以下是对数据库设计基本步骤的总结。

一、数据库设计的基本步骤总结

步骤 说明
1. 需求分析 收集并分析用户对数据库的需求,明确系统功能和数据处理要求。
2. 概念结构设计 建立反映现实世界实体及其关系的抽象模型,常用工具为E-R图。
3. 逻辑结构设计 将概念模型转换为特定数据库管理系统支持的数据模型(如关系模型)。
4. 物理结构设计 确定数据库在存储设备上的物理结构,包括索引、分区等优化策略。
5. 数据库实施 根据设计结果创建数据库,导入数据,并进行测试。
6. 数据库维护与优化 对数据库进行监控、备份、恢复以及性能调优。

二、详细说明

1. 需求分析

在开始设计之前,必须与用户深入沟通,了解业务流程、数据内容、数据使用方式等。这是整个设计的基础,如果需求分析不到位,可能导致后续设计反复甚至失败。

2. 概念结构设计

这一步主要通过E-R图(实体-联系图)来表示数据之间的关系。它不涉及具体的数据库管理系统,而是从宏观角度描述数据模型。

3. 逻辑结构设计

将E-R图转化为关系模式,确定表结构、字段类型、主键、外键等。此阶段需要考虑数据完整性、一致性等问题。

4. 物理结构设计

考虑如何将逻辑结构映射到实际的存储结构中,比如选择合适的存储引擎、设置索引、分区策略等,以提高查询效率。

5. 数据库实施

使用SQL语句或数据库管理工具创建数据库对象,如表、视图、索引等,并导入初始数据。同时需要进行功能测试和性能测试。

6. 数据库维护与优化

数据库上线后,需要定期进行备份、恢复演练、性能监控和调整。随着业务增长,可能需要重新设计部分结构以适应新的需求。

三、小结

数据库设计是一个系统化的过程,需要结合业务需求和技术实现进行综合考量。每个阶段都至关重要,不能跳过或忽视。合理的设计不仅能提升系统的运行效率,还能降低后期维护成本。因此,在实际工作中应严格按照设计流程进行,确保数据库的稳定性和扩展性。

  免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。

 
分享:
最新文章